What caused that below-par run by star 3YO Foxwedge at Randwick? Trainer John O'Shea blames a mucus build-up in the horse's trachea. So there you have it. A snotty nose. O'Shea says: 'We had him scoped straight after the race because he has never run a bad race and the vets found his trachea was full of mucus and he virtually couldn't breathe...There is no infection because his bloods were fine before the race. He has just had an allergic reaction to something.'

How about that stunning win by Atlantic Jewel in the Sapphire! No wonder she's now a hot fav for the Cox Plate. Trainer Mark Kavanagh says: 'She leaves me speechless...it was remarkable what she did out there. She sat four deep, Roddy was just arrogant and she just strode away...It's fabulous.' Kav admits he is undecided what to do next with the Jewel. Maybe it will be one more run - and then away with her for the spring?
